Key Responsibilities
- Prepare and analyze financial statements, ensuring accuracy and compliance with relevant accounting standards (e.g., IFRS, GAAP).
- Lead and support internal and external audit processes, preparing necessary documentation and liaising with auditors.
- Develop and implement tax strategies, ensuring compliance with corporate tax laws and identifying opportunities for tax optimization.
- Provide strategic financial analysis and insights to support corporate decision-making, including budgeting, forecasting, and investment appraisals.
- Manage corporate finance activities such as cash flow management, capital budgeting, and financial risk assessment.
- Ensure adherence to all financial regulations and internal policies, proactively identifying and mitigating financial risks.
- Collaborate with various departments to gather financial data, streamline processes, and improve financial reporting.
- Mentor junior staff and contribute to the continuous improvement of accounting practices and systems.
Required Skills
- Proven experience in corporate finance, audit, and tax accounting.
- Strong understanding of IFRS/GAAP and other relevant accounting principles.
-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making abilities.
- Proficiency in accounting software (e.g., SAP, Oracle, Xero) and advanced Excel skills.
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, capable of explaining complex financial information clearly.
- High level of attention to detail and accuracy.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et strict deadlines.
Preferred Qualifications
- ACA, ACCA, CIMA, or equivalent professional accounting qualification.
- Master's deg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field.
- Experience with financial modeling and business valuation techniques.
- Familiarity with specific tax regimes relevant to the UK corporate landscape.
- Previous experience in a financial services or professional services environment.
